Graduate / Trainee Marketing Assistant Crewe - Hybrid Up to £30,000
Are you an organised, proactive and detail-focused marketer looking for your next opportunity? We're looking for a Marketing Coordinator to support our client's wider Marketing function and ensure the smooth delivery of marketing activity across the UK and North American markets. This is an ideal role for someone who enjoys variety, takes ownership, and wants to develop within a fast-paced, global environment.
If you are currently a Marketing Coordinator, Marketing Assistant, or Marketing Executive, this opportunity is not to be missed!
The Role
Working as part of a collaborative Marketing team, you'll play a key role in coordinating campaigns, supporting events, and ensuring marketing activity is delivered effectively across multiple regions. From managing marketing materials to working with suppliers and supporting exhibitions, this role is perfect for someone who is hands-on, adaptable and eager to learn.
Key Responsibilities
- Support day-to-day marketing operations, including coordinating campaigns across the UK and North America
- Manage the production and distribution of marketing materials such as brochures, presentations and digital assets
- Ensure all marketing output is consistent and aligned with brand standards

How to prepare for a job interview at Get Recruited
✨Know Your Marketing Basics
Brush up on your marketing fundamentals before the interview. Understand key concepts like campaign coordination, brand consistency, and digital asset management. This will help you speak confidently about how you can contribute to their marketing efforts.
✨Showcase Your Organisational Skills
Since the role requires a detail-focused approach, be ready to share examples of how you've successfully managed multiple tasks or projects in the past. Use specific instances where your organisational skills made a difference in a marketing project.
✨Demonstrate Adaptability
This position is all about being hands-on and adaptable. Prepare to discuss times when you had to pivot quickly or take on new responsibilities. Highlight your eagerness to learn and grow within a fast-paced environment.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ions that show your interest in the company and the role. Inquire about their current marketing campaigns or how they measure success in their marketing activities. This shows you're engaged and thinking ahead!
